Multiple DSP Module (MDM)
A resource must be available on the system for an application to use it. If the resident
DSPs are fully allocated to resources or protocols, capacity for more resources can be
added by installing a Multiple DSP Module (MDM) in an open TMS slot and loading
the image definitions for the resources required. These resources are in addition to the
MPS resource itself. Examples of TMS supported resources are:
Player (ply) - Vocabularies or audio data can be played from local memory
on the TMS motherboard.
DTMF Receiver (dtmf) and Call Progress Detection (cpd) - Phone line
events such as touch-tone entry, hook-flash, dial tone, busy signals, etc. can
be detected.
Tone Generator (tgen) - In lieu of playing tones as vocabularies, DTMF
and other tones can be generated.
R1 Transmit (r1tx), R1 Receive (r1rx), and R2 (r2) - Tone generators
and detectors to support R1 and R2 protocols.
The MDM contains 12 DSPs for configuration of additional resources. There are no
indicators or connectors on the front panel of the MDM. The only visible indication
that an MDM is installed in a TMS slot (versus a blank), is the presence of bend tabs
near the center of the front bracket that secure it to the MDM circuit board.
Configuration of resources and protocols is covered in Base System Configuration on
page 64.
